I agree with your first statement, but under the soft deletion system,
policy violations would be managed like they always are. A user
reverting a soft del redirect without cause is no different from a
user reposting deleted material without cause. The difference is that
anyone can help with the deletion part, unbalancing the current
asymmetry (anyone can post a non-notable bio, only the small number of
users who are admins can remove it).
